I don't know if this is relevant but I found a list of bluetooth dongles compatible and non-compatible with the wiimote.
http://wiibrew.org/wiki/List_of_Working_Bluetooth_Devices

But that's probably not the case. The pairing process can be a tad fiddly. Hold 1+2 and click pair, once you get 'HID device ready' hit pair up again and it should connect, if not hit refresh after the second HID device is ready.
